The yard next door has bamboo, and it is spreading through the chain link fence into my yard. What can I do to control and or stop it? |
Either root pruning or a physical barrier will keep running bamboo in check. For root pruning you'll need a spade. Just push the spade into the ground and remove it. Go all around the area that you want to stop the bamboo from encroaching. This cuts the roots and keeps the bamboo in check. It is a simple method and will work if done correctly twice a year, mid to late summer and in the fall. Or, you can dig a trench 24" deep and 4" wide and then fill it with concrete. Or you can line the trench with 30 mil plastic or set sheets of galvanized patio covering in the trench. The fiberglass or galvanized metal sheets come in 24" wide, 6-12' long panels. Just set them on their sides in the trench and then cover over with soil. Best wishes with your project! |
